Transaction f34603dccefd00ffa17f88cc9708c137e63adf947e7d3031a4d229129fa43a39
1 Input
1 Output
-
f34603dccefd00ffa17f88cc9708c137e63adf947e7d3031a4d229129fa43a39:0
- value
- 1009008
- script pubkey
- OP_0 OP_PUSHBYTES_20 117ccc313f83b0ac13e68c040e074f34196691d6
- address
- bc1qz97vcvflswc2cylx3szqup60xsvkdywku38whq